Somebody's darling

The head stone on the left has the inscription 'Somebody's Darling 1865''. The inscription on the right headstone is for the man who buried somebody's darling. Could be a really intriguing story or simply a reminder that so many people died, no one knew who they were but they did belong to somebody. Sad.

This two head stone graveyard is well preserved and is on the backroad between Millers Flat and Beaumont.
